Hi on-call,

The Tarnwell orphaned-resource sweeper ships tonight to the Ashgrove production cluster. It scans hourly for volumes and load balancers with no owning deployment, tags them, and deletes anything tagged for more than 72 hours. If you see unexpected deletions, disable the sweeper via its feature flag and page the Corvane infra team — do not manually restore resources first. For correlation in logs, the deployed build token is recorded directly below.

pipeline stamp: htk3_cc5

The garage occupancy feed for the Brindlewood campus arrives over a message queue every thirty seconds, one record per level, published by the Stallgrid edge boxes. Counts can briefly go negative when a sensor double-fires on exit; the ingest job clamps these to zero and flags the interval. If the feed stalls for more than five minutes, the dashboard falls back to the last known snapshot. Sensor mappings, queue names, and the replay procedure are documented on the internal page below.

runbook for tahog-kadug: https://gitlab.qirvanworks.corp/projects/pages/view/b139298aed28

/* Maximum node count rendered by the Spindlework dependency
 * graph visualizer before it collapses clusters into summary
 * nodes. Raising this past 2000 makes the layout pass crawl on
 * older laptops, so coordinate with the perf channel first.
 * The build token that validated this limit is noted below. */

pipeline stamp: htk21_86b657ac0aa916a9af17f

# Graphlet environments

Quick rundown for release: Graphlet (our dependency graph visualizer) has three environments — sandbox, staging, and prod. Sandbox rebuilds nightly from synthetic repos, staging mirrors prod data a day behind, and prod is the real deal. Promote sandbox → staging → prod, never skip. Each environment reads its own config; prod's current values are below:

deployment values, fahap-hahaf:
[casdor]
port = 9200
region = south-2
host = casdor.qirvanworks.corp
timeout_ms = 3000
retries = 4